Opinion of the Court

The named defendant’s petition for certification for appeal from the Appellate Court, 54 Conn. App. 251 (AC 17948), is granted, limited to the following issue:

“Did the Appellate Court improperly conclude that the 180 day time limitation for filing a complaint under General Statutes § 46a-82 (e) was subject matter jurisdictional?”

KATZ and VERTEFEUILLE, Js., did not participate in the consideration or decision of this petition.
